engine will not start.
 
28 Wellcraft whose port engine will not start unless one pounds on it
with a hammer. I am told that this is due to a stuck solenoid. I was
told I would need a rebuilt starter or a new solenoid. Who is right and
is this information acurate? Thanks, Bill Fletcher.


Fishnutzz April 21st 05 06:37 AM

Solenoid is your problem. Probably have to remove the starter to remove the
solenoid. The problem is the copper disc and the terminals are lumpy from
metal transfer and possibly corrosion and can be removed and cleaned up. On
the other hand, what's a new solenoid cost?
